1. A cart for storing and transporting granular material comprising:

  • a. a frame supported by a plurality of wheels;

    b. a storage bin connected to said frame, said storage bin including a first and second pair of opposing sidewalls;

    said first pair of opposing sidewalls converging downwardly and inwardly to a trough and a sump extending across a bottom of said storage bin;

    said trough extending across a first portion of said bottom of said storage bin and opening into said sump at a discharge end thereof;

    said sump extending across a second portion of said bottom of said storage bin and positioned adjacent said discharge end of said trough;

    a portion of said sump extending lower than said trough;

    said sump opening directly to said bin;

    one of said sidewalls of said second pair of opposing sidewalls sloping downwardly and inwardly to an end of said sump opposite said discharge end of said trough;

    c. a drag auger rotatably secured in said trough and having a discharge end aligned with said trough discharge end; and

    d. an unloading chute secured to said storage bin and having an unloading auger rotatably secured therein;

    a lower end of said unloading auger extending into said sump such that at least a portion of said lower end of said unloading auger is positioned lower than and adjacent to said drag auger discharge end;

    said unloading chute extending upwardly and away from said storage bin.
